我可以像使用innerHTML或其他方法一样通过javascript来更改字体大小吗?
<iframe frameborder="0" src="javascript:'<html></html>';" id="iframe1" title="" style="width: 100%;height: 416px;margin: 0px;padding: 0px;">
<!DOCTYPE html>
<html>
<head>
<style></style>
</head>
<body style="font-size:12px;"> HELLO WORLD </body></html>
</iframe>
这意味着当iframe加载或聚焦时,字体大小必须更改。
答案 0 :(得分:0)
尝试:
document.body.style.fontSize="12px";
答案 1 :(得分:0)
您可以添加一些JavaScript来更改字体大小。
document.body.style.fontSize = '15px'
答案 2 :(得分:0)
访问w3schools.com,您可以在其中获得带有示例的更多详细信息
document.body.style.fontSize =“ 20px”;
答案 3 :(得分:0)
您可以使用 getElementsByTagName 来添加正文的样式。
document.getElementsByTagName("body")[0].style.fontSize = "20px";
document.getElementsByTagName("body")[0].style.fontSize = "20px";
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<!DOCTYPE html>
<html>
<head>
<style></style>
</head>
<body style="font-size:12px;"> HELLO WORLD </body></html>
答案 4 :(得分:0)
这是将所有文本转换为所需字体大小的代码。
document.onreadystatechange = function () {
if (document.readyState == "complete") {
var your-str = document.getElementsByTagName("body")[0];
var obj-store-style-property = your-str.fontsize(12);
document.getElementsByTagName("body").innerHTML = obj-store-style-property;
}
}
答案 5 :(得分:0)
$("#iframe1").contents().find("body").css('font-size','20px');
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
<iframe frameborder="0" src="javascript:'<html></html>';" id="iframe1" title="" style="width: 100%;height: 416px;margin: 0px;padding: 0px;">
<!DOCTYPE html>
<html>
<head>
</head>
<body style="font-size:12px;"> HELLO WORLD </body></html>
</iframe>
答案 6 :(得分:-2)
document.getElementById(“ test”)。innerHTML ='我的文字';